What Kinds of Delta 8 THC Products Can I Buy in Massachusetts?

Delta 8 THC can be found in all kinds of delivery methods and product types.  So, it is important to consider each one to figure out which is right based on your unique preferences and goals.

  • Vape Cartridges: Pre-filled D8 vape carts offer fast-acting, potent delta 8 alongside terpenes in various strains.  Carts are 510-threaded to be compatible with any standard vape pen.
  • Disposable Vapes: D8 disposable vapes are another great choice that come in lots of strains while being fast-acting and potent.  These all-in-one systems require no charging or maintenance of any kind.
  • Edibles: D8 edibles are associated with several hours of effects and a unique body high experience.  Available in a huge array of delicious flavors, and gummies are the most popular.
  • Tinctures: D8 tinctures are administered sublingually, and they come in different milligram strengths while offering a nice balance between potency and duration of effects.
  • Capsules: D8 capsules offer a simpler way to ingest the properties of delta 8 THC for long-lasting effects.
  • Flower: D8 flower is simply raw CBD flower infused with delta 8 THC distillate.  Available in both pre-rolls and loose buds, as well as in a large variety of strains.
  • Dabs: D8 dabs are powerful concentrates recommended for experienced users only.  They are vaporized through a dabbing device, which achieves higher temperatures than standard equipment.
  • Topicals: D8 topicals work in a localized way with the muscles and joints, as it won’t get you high.
